Running Compliant OpenMP Applications on top of StarPU with the Klang-Omp Compiler

Several robust runtime systems proposed recently have shown the benefits of task-based parallelism models. However, the common weakness of these supports is to tie applications to specific APIs. The OpenMP specification aims at providing a common parallel programming means for shared-memory platforms. It appears a good candidate to address this issue. We assessed the effectiveness and limits of this approach on the ScalFMM library developed by Inria HiePACS team, implementing fast multipole methods (FMM) algorithms. We showed that OpenMP dependent tasks allow for significant performance improvements over OpenMP loops and independent tasks for this application. We also demonstrated that suitable, targeted language extensions can further improve performances by a important margin in some cases.
